On
June 3, 2019,
the Company’s Board of Directors declared a
two
-for-
one
stock split of the Company’s common stock effected in the form of a
100%
share dividend distributed on
June 28, 2019
to record holders as of
June 17, 2019.
All share and per share values in this report have been adjusted to retroactively reflect the effect of the
two
-for-
one
stock split.
